Transaction 031232048e642c584603df59763c5c521f7a7a4404a2b45758fb1c2570b0fae6

1 Input
1 Outputs
  • 031232048e642c584603df59763c5c521f7a7a4404a2b45758fb1c2570b0fae6:0
  • value  6943956
    address  17cP2DCX3yGWdbeJGq9EPhjZLEPbCxqjzZ